What is a Mesothelioma Lawsuit?

A mesothelioma lawsuit can be described as an official claim filed by asbestos victims or their family members to collect financial compensation from negligent asbestos producers. Mesothelioma victims seek compensation to help cover their medical expenses loss of income, living costs and other losses.

After a mesothelioma suit is filed, attorneys for the plaintiff and defendant seek to gather evidence and negotiate an agreement for settlement. If a settlement is not reached the case will be taken to trial before a jury or judge. More than 95 percent of mesothelioma cases are settled.

Patients who are diagnosed with mesothelioma asbestosis or any other asbestos-related illness can file a personal injury or wrongful death lawsuit against the asbestos company or companies responsible for their exposure. A court-appointed estate representative or a loved one's family members may make a claim on behalf of a deceased mesothelioma sufferer.

Millions of dollars have been recovered in settlements by victims through lawsuits against asbestos manufacturers. However, these funds might not suffice to cover all of your expenses. Your lawyer will have to show you that your mesothelioma or asbestos-related illness is directly linked to exposure to asbestos in order to get you the compensation you deserve.

The statute of limitations, which determines the length of time it takes to file a lawsuit, differs by state. It is essential to contact a lawyer who is experienced immediately is crucial to determine how much time remains to file a claim.

Many asbestos manufacturers have set up trust funds to compensate those who are injured by their products. A reputable mesothelioma attorney can help you determine whether there is a trust fund and will guide you through the steps of filing claims. In the average, mesothelioma survivors receive $1 million or more in settlements. These settlements can have a profound impact for families of victims as well as the victims.

Can an individual from the family bring a lawsuit against mesothelioma?

If a mesothelioma sufferer passes away, their loved ones may be eligible to file a wrongful death lawsuit. This type of claim may help families recover compensation from financial losses that result from the loss of an individual in their family. Families could also be entitled to compensation due to the physical and emotional pain they endured after the loss of a loved ones.

Mesothelioma lawyers can help victims and their families in filing asbestos wrongful death claims. Lawyers can ensure that paperwork is filed in a timely and correct manner. They can also help families locate mesothelioma lawyers who are reputable to collaborate with.

Families could also be compensated for funeral expenses or medical expenses as well as other expenses associated with mesothelioma. Settlements for wrongful demises are often huge. This is because mesothelioma can be a painful and aggressive disease. It can wreak havoc on a person's life, both financially and emotionally.

The law governing who is able to sue for wrongful death for mesothelioma victims varies by state. In the majority of states the victim's immediate family members (such as spouses and children) can bring a lawsuit. In certain instances life partners, or non-family members can also be able to file a claim for wrongful death.

A mesothelioma lawyer can decide whether the estate representative is able to file a lawsuit for the wrongful death of the deceased. They can then begin an exploratory investigation to learn more about the various asbestos products the victim was exposed to and which manufacturers were responsible for the exposure.

Once the mesothelioma lawyer has completed their investigation and has filed an action for wrongful death on behalf of the victim. The asbestos companies named in the lawsuit will then be given the opportunity to respond, either by settling the claim or by disputing the claim, and then beginning the trial process.

The majority of mesothelioma lawyers will try to negotiate a monetary settlement for mesothelioma with defendants prior to going to court. This is due to the fact that the verdict of a juror can be unpredictable. A settlement is usually more cost-effective.
